About the Role
Head Golf Professional | Focus: Day-to-day execution, programming, and member engagement
• Assisting in managing all aspects of the entire Golf Operation including but not limited to the golf shop operation, golf instruction, outside operations team, locker rooms, tournament program, and golf shop merchandising.
• Promote and teach the game of golf, specifically the junior programming.
• Assist the Director of Golf in recruitment, hiring, training, and retention of professional staff that successfully services the needs of the membership.
• Responsible for the Golf Shop schedule and making sure coverage is properly distributed.
• Assists the Golf Shop Manager in physical inventory and display of merchandise.
• Assists with the Director of Golf in preparation of budgets by reviewing both revenue and expenses on a monthly and annual basis.
• Manages the Handicap System (GHIN) and reminder e-mails for posting.
• Assists the Director of Golf in developing the Club’s annual Golf Event Schedule.
• Ensures proper billing of daily charges and fees for all golf-related activities.
• Develop a close relationship with the General Manager, Clubhouse Manager, Food & Beverage, Golf Course Superintendent, Communications, and Human Resources.
• Assist the Director of Golf with communication to the membership regarding all golf related news and updates.
• Enforce all Club rules governing golf course usage while representing Riverton Country Club’s missions and values.
• Mentor and train our Assistant Professional staff and prepare them for career advancement.
• Performs other duties as needed assigned by the Director of Golf.
• Represent the club by playing golf with members, as time and responsibilities permit.
Qualifications & Experience:
• PGA Member in good standing.
• 3+ Years Experience as a Head Professional or Assistant Golf Professional
• Broad experience working with men, women, and juniors/children – we are a family focused Club.
• Experience with Golf Genius, Trackman, Jonas, ForeTees and Microsoft Office
• Bachelor’s degree in a related field from four-year college or university recommended.
